Output 3895884c88ba16fb30d2cc51110e5a5754097d0a62f99678066c406ce609992e:22

value
8019
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a6f5a45d10fabf9ed33a16b9a270075bac20ecf4ca51793c6329ebca92eaa7cc
address
bc1p5m66ghgsl2lea5e6z6u6yuq8twkzpm85efghj0rr984u4yh25lxqavvul8
transaction
3895884c88ba16fb30d2cc51110e5a5754097d0a62f99678066c406ce609992e
spent
true